What is Banian Cloth?

Banian cloth is a type of hand-woven textile characterized by its unique patterns and motifs. Traditionally, it is made from cotton or silk and is often used to create shawls, dresses, and other clothing items. The craftsmanship and cultural significance of Banian cloth make it a valuable investment for many buyers.

# Key Characteristics of Banian Cloth

- Material: Typically made from cotton or silk, with silk being more expensive.

- Design: Intricate patterns and vibrant colors, often reflecting local tribal art.

- Usage: Commonly used for shawls, dresses, and decorative items.

Factors Influencing Banian Cloth Prices

Several factors determine the price of Banian cloth. Understanding these can help you make a better purchase decision.

# 1. Material Quality

The type of material used significantly impacts the price. Silk Banian cloth is more expensive than cotton due to its luxurious feel and durability. High-quality silk Banian cloth can fetch prices upwards of $200, while cotton versions may range from $50 to $150.

# 2. Design Complexity

The complexity of the design also plays a crucial role. Intricate and detailed patterns require more time and skill to create, thus increasing the price. Simple designs may cost between $50 and $100, while highly detailed pieces can cost $200 or more.

# 3. Cultural Significance

Certain Banian cloths have cultural significance and are highly valued by collectors. These pieces often come with a higher price tag due to their rarity and historical value.

# 4. Brand and Origin

Banian cloth from reputable brands or specific regions may command higher prices. For example, Banian cloth from the Kaghan Valley in Pakistan is renowned for its quality and is often more expensive than those from other regions.

Where to Buy Banian Cloth

There are several places where you can purchase Banian cloth. Each offers unique advantages in terms of price, quality, and authenticity.

# 1. Online Marketplaces

Online platforms like Etsy, Amazon, and eBay offer a wide range of Banian cloth options. You can find both new and vintage pieces, with prices varying based on quality and seller reputation. Always read reviews and check the seller's ratings to ensure authenticity.

# 2. Local Markets

Visiting local markets in regions where Banian cloth is produced can provide you with the opportunity to buy directly from weavers. This can sometimes result in better prices and the ability to negotiate.

# 3. Specialty Stores

Specialty stores that focus on ethnic and traditional textiles often carry high-quality Banian cloth. These stores may offer a curated selection and provide expert advice on choosing the right piece.

Tips for Buying Banian Cloth

When purchasing Banian cloth, consider the following tips to ensure you get the best value:

# 1. Research Prices

Before making a purchase, research the typical prices of Banian cloth to ensure you are getting a fair deal. Look at prices from multiple sources to compare.

# 2. Check for Authenticity

Ensure the Banian cloth is authentic. Look for signs of hand-woven craftsmanship and check the material quality. Authentic pieces often come with a certificate of authenticity.

# 3. Consider Your Purpose

Think about how you intend to use the Banian cloth. If you plan to wear it frequently, investing in a higher-quality piece may be worthwhile. For decorative purposes, a more affordable option might suffice.

# 4. Negotiate Prices

In local markets, don't hesitate to negotiate the price. Weavers often have some flexibility and may be willing to offer a discount, especially if you are making a bulk purchase.
